About Remember the Titans

Remember the Titans follows a Virginia high school football program at a turning point when a new head coach, Herman Boone, is hired to lead a team just forced to integrate. Boone, played with firm resolve by Denzel Washington, clashes with the popular former coach Bill Yoast, portrayed by Will Patton, who is reassigned to a defensive coordinator role. The two men must set aside personal pride as players from different backgrounds are asked to train together, confront lingering prejudice, and learn to trust one another. Through grueling conditioning, hard choices, and shared hardship, the squad begins to see that discipline and dialogue can bend old tensions. The season tests loyalties, reshapes identities, and points toward a larger understanding of teamwork.

Directed by Boaz Yakin and released in 2000, Remember the Titans is adapted from a screenplay by Gregory Allen Howard inspired by real events surrounding a racially integrated high school football program in Virginia. The film spotlights teamwork over division.

With a production budget of 30 million, the film earned about 136.7 million worldwide, marking a strong commercial performance that helped solidify Disney's mid budget live action line during that era and proving its broad family appeal beyond sports fans.

The movie has left a lasting mark in popular culture, frequently used in classrooms to discuss race and leadership. It helped normalize the idea that shared goals can override prejudice, and its football sequences still surface in sports media and motivational discussions. The film's themes ripple into discussions about community building, school policy, and how teams can model social change in real life.

Critics praised the strong ensemble and earnest tone, while some noted simplified depictions of racially charged dynamics. Its themes center on resilience, mentorship, and unity forged through hardship, making it a memorable example of inspirational sports cinema.

Audiences remember the 1971 setup at T.C. Williams High as a crowd-pleasing blend of football grit and social change, led by Denzel Washington's coaching presence and a diverse, hungry team. They note the film borrows from real events but trims tensions and hammers toward a tidy unity arc rather than a full history lesson. The emotional moments land differently for viewers, with some tearing up at the big game while others find the depiction of some teams and events overly simplified.

It's inspired by the real 1971 T.C. Williams High School football team in Virginia. Denzel Washington's Coach Herman Boone and Will Patton's Coach Bill Yoast are based on real people, though the film dramatizes some events for the story.
